Job description

Staffordshire County Council,

Staffordshire County Council is a modern, forward‑thinking authority with big ambitions. We empower our people to be bold, innovative and to take pride in the work they do.

Staffordshire Legal Services is one of the largest and most diverse in‑house legal teams in the region, providing high‑quality, high‑impact work across every Council function, the Staffordshire Pension Fund, and a wide range of external clients. Our caseload is consistently interesting, varied, and often high profile.

Why Join Us?
  • We genuinely prioritise work–life balance—our staff survey tells us we don’t just say it, we live it. Our benefits include:
  • Generous holiday allowance, increasing with service, plus the option to purchase additional leave
  • Agile, flexible and term‑time working arrangements
  • Local Government Pension Scheme with generous (29.5%) employer contributions
  • Employee discounts, staff parking discounts, and an optional car lease scheme
  • Family‑friendly policies, including maternity, adoption, paternity and parental leave
  • A collaborative, supportive team culture where your contribution truly matters
Main Responsibilities

Your work will include:

  • Advising on a full range of County Planning matters, including planning applications and enforcement
  • Negotiating complex planning obligations on behalf of highways and education clients
  • Providing expert advice on a broad range of Local Authority statutory planning functions
  • Managing a varied and challenging caseload in line with Lexcel standards
  • Supervising and supporting colleagues within the team
The Ideal Candidate

You will be a qualified Solicitor, Barrister, or Chartered Legal Executive (with practice/advocacy rights) who brings:

  • A strong understanding of Planning Law
  • Clear, confident communication skills
  • Excellent attention to detail and organisational abilities
  • The capability to work under pressure and manage competing priorities
  • A collaborative approach, including the ability to delegate and manage a team effectively

Interviews will take place during week commencing 28th September 2026.
